Output 26bc17ea089d03a9d55c3059b9400fcdf9d39ae86e69b10c3cd36d960d72d158:0

value
708446456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 471b62b75b03b475281dbab392af69e32337c714 OP_EQUAL
address
38Azhx1cSJXHa8oo3jXkSdP4kpk2Ccz3u3
transaction
26bc17ea089d03a9d55c3059b9400fcdf9d39ae86e69b10c3cd36d960d72d158
confirmations
517643
spent
true